Supreme Court Ruling on TPS

  • 🎯 The Supreme Court has allowed the Trump administration to end Temporary Protected Status (TPS) for hundreds of thousands of Venezuelans, marking a significant win for the administration.
  • βš–οΈ The ruling allows the federal government to end TPS, though the legal battle will return to a lower court.
  • ⏳ This decision is separate from the ongoing legal fight concerning the deportation of accused gang members under the Alien Enemies Act.

Implications of the Ruling

  • 🌍 TPS is a program designed to protect individuals from deportation to countries experiencing natural disasters or civil unrest.
  • πŸ“„ The federal law permits the use of this special parole provision on a case-by-case basis, a method not employed by the Biden administration.
  • πŸ“ˆ If individuals remain in the country past two years, other protections could activate, making them as difficult to deport as other immigrants in the slow immigration process.

Dissenting Opinion

  • πŸ—£οΈ Justice Jackson was the sole dissenting voice in this Supreme Court decision.
  • πŸ—“οΈ The court is expected to issue further rulings in the coming weeks as they conclude their term.
